Emblem, insignia and symbology of Lahbabi

Although not all lineages are assigned an emblem, insignia or coat of arms, it is always enriching to investigate the symbology of the surname Lahbabi. It is essential to keep in mind that the connection between an emblem and the surname Lahbabi is usually rooted in the history and tradition of nobility, chivalry or illustrious families of a society. The custom of granting and using coats of arms originated in Europe during the Middle Ages, primarily as a form of identification on the battlefield, but also as a symbol of status, power and legacy.

Connection between the family coat of arms and the surname Lahbabi

The interrelationship between the heraldic shield and Lahbabi is intricate but fascinating. Initially, coats of arms were awarded to individuals and not to an entire progeny, being associated with the person who obtained them for achievements, prowess in combat, or social status. With the passage of time, the Lahbabi blazon became hereditary, becoming a recognizable emblem of the family lineage, closely linked to the surname Lahbabi.
